Video game to help decide real life baseball game

June 22, 2005 at 11:22 AM

A game between the independent Kansas City T-Bones and the Schaumburg Flyers will begin virtually with two innings on the Xbox instead of out in the field. Two contest winners will play MVP Baseball 2005 with created teams for two innings, and the score after that match-up will carry over to the real game when the two actual teams take the field.
